Suspected safe thief in court over Harrietsham burglary

A suspected safe thief has appeared in court.

Jordan Boguslawski, 36, of no fixed address, is alleged to have taken two safes containing cash, personal documents and pieces of jewellery from a home in Sandway Road, Harrietsham, near Maidstone.

The man was arrested by Surrey Roads Police on the M23 on Saturday.

He was also arrested in connection with a burglary in Hemel Hempsted, Hertfordshire, reported the same day.

Boguslawski was charged with two counts of burglary on Monday.

He was remanded in custody to appear at Medway Magistrates’ Court today.

At the hearing, he was further remanded in custody to appear at Maidstone Crown Court on Tuesday, October 22.
